Helping students navigate nutrition’s tough topics for a deeper understanding

The Science of Nutrition offers the best combination of text and media to help students master the toughest nutrition concepts in the course, while providing the richest support to save instructors’ time. This best selling, thoroughly current, research-based nutrition text is uniquely organized around the highly regarded functional approach, which organizes vitamins and minerals based on their functions within the body and is easily seen in the organization of the micronutrient (vitamin and mineral) chapters.

The Fourth Edition enhances the student learning story with greater incorporation of learning outcomes throughout the text; an increased visual impact with the inclusion of new Focus Figures, including Meal Focus Figures; and a strong media story with new assets in MasteringNutrition, including revised nutrition animations. Important hot topics and new research such as the latest dietary guidelines and Nutrition Facts panel, a revised global hunger chapter (to incorporate more coverage of domestic issues, including sustainability and environmental impacts, food equity, politics, etc.), and updated science and source information make this one of the most current texts on the market today.
